I see two potential problems with this:
1) same as with voting, I don't see a reason to restrict this to just
text conferencing - any remote communication method which can verify the
identity of the participant could be acceptable.
2) I would like to see something which indicates that the system must
also meet the requirement for concurrency - if the remote communication
mechanism breaks, the meeting should not continue any more than if a
fire alarm went off at a physical meeting location.
